Since Watchfinder & Co. was first founded in 2002, it has grown to become the premier resource from which to buy and sell premium pre-owned watches. With thousands of watches available from more than 50 brands, including Rolex, Omega, IWC and more, plus boutiques across the UK and a manufacturer certified service centre, Watchfinder has established itself as the top pre-owned watch specialist.

How will you make an impact?
- Commercial Planning (Support Role)
- Support the coordination and consolidation of sales forecasts during financial planning cycles (e.g., Budget, Latest Estimates) in collaboration with Marketing and Finance.
- Assist in maintaining the global daily sales report (e.g., via Metabase or other reporting tools) and contribute to daily performance commentary.
- Support the preparation of monthly sales targets for country managers, considering sales trends, marketing investments and historical performance data.
- Contribute to the preparation of commercial planning and performance reporting.
- Assist in gathering and validating data inputs for planning cycles.
- Support the preparation of sales and purchasing performance data used for commission calculations.
- Model future commissions based on updated scheme.
- Support the implementation and tracking of commission scheme frameworks in collaboration with HR and Finance.
- Partner with payroll for payout calculations.
- Answer ad hoc questions on commissions from sales team.
- Conduct structured commercial analysis on sales performance, identifying trends and key drivers (marketing calendar, stock availability, seasonality, etc.).
- Support the analysis of commercial initiatives (e.g., incentives, promotions, merchandising) against targets.
- Support the development and monitoring of retail KPIs, including boutique-level performance metrics.
- Contribute to retail performance analysis across different stock models (owned, consignment, marketplace).
- Assist with workload and capacity planning analysis based on forecasted volumes.
- Contribute to the commercial section of monthly focus documents and quarterly business reviews.
- Partner with the Data team to improve reporting accuracy and develop new commercial reports.
- Continuously identify opportunities to improve reporting efficiency and data quality.
